Cooperation and communication in the team
A training course dedicated to managers, focused on the development of effective team management skills through a deep understanding of team roles. The workshop program is based on the practical application of the concept of team roles in everyday managerial work. Participants will learn and practice a variety of management techniques tailored to the specifics of each role assumed by employees in a team. The workshop is conducted with practical exercises that allow immediate application of the knowledge gained.

Training program
Day 1: Team communication and conflict resolution
- Team communication — components of effective communication, barriers, sender and receiver responsibility
- Effectiveness of on-site and remote teams — specifics of communication in distributed teams
- Conflict as a source of relationship difficulties — sources of conflict, escalation, consequences for the team
- Communication self-assessment questionnaire — checking how precisely I communicate with others
- Partnership framework and WIN-WIN principle (Dr. Dudley Weeks) — the first step to resolving conflicts constructively
- Exercises: communication self-assessment, conflict resolution simulation using the WIN-WIN method
Day 2: Communication tools and team roles
- I-Message (Dr. Thomas Gordon) — three parts of the message, application in difficult conversations, effects vs You-Message
- Cordial vs aggressive directiveness — impact on subordinates' behaviors and attitudes, how to be firm without aggression
- My Role in the Team questionnaire — diagnosis of eight most common roles and corresponding behaviors
- Managing employees based on team role — minimizing conflicts, fostering motivation, building a strong team
- Psychological roles in the team — the impact of roles on group dynamics and cooperation effectiveness
- Exercises: practical application of the I-Message, team role diagnosis and management strategy development
